Mourinho Free For Real Madrid Return

Jose Mourinho has given Real Madrid president, Fiorentino Perez, some conditions to meet before he can take charge of Real Madrid.

A respected journalist, Francesc Aguilar, who works for Mundo Deportivo, made this known.

In his report, Mourinho wants Madrid to sign a new centre-half and a striker; conditions if met, will see him return to the club which he managed from 2010-2013.

During his spell with the Spanish giants, he won the La Liga and the Copa del Rey before returning to England for a second spell with Chelsea.

Mourinho was sacked some weeks ago as manager of Manchester United after the club had struggled to win.

However, Real president Florentino Perez remains a fan and with the club 10 points behind La Liga leaders Barca and outside the Champions League places pressure is mounting on Solari, who could be relieved of his duties before his contract expires at the end of the season.

“There has been no contact, but they did get in touch with Jose after (Julen) Lopetegui was dismissed (in late October),” the Mail reports the source as saying.

“He told them he was the manager of Manchester United and totally committed to the club.”
